Raja's cap is in the form of a right circular cone of base radius 3 cm and slant height 25 cm. Find the area of the sheet required to make a cap. (Use π=3.14\pi = 3.14 correct to closest integer value )

A.

450 sq. cm.

B.

236 sq. cm.

C.

350 sq. cm.

D.

50 sq. cm.

Correct option is B

Given:
The shape of the cap is a right circular cone.
Base radius of the cone (r) = 3 cm.
Slant height of the cone (l) = 25 cm.
π = 3.14.
Formula Used:
Curved surface area (CSA) = π r l
Where r is the radius of the base, and l is the slant height of the cone.
The area of the sheet required to make the cap is equal to the curved surface area.
Solution:
Substituting the given values into the formula:
CSA = 3.14 × 3 × 25
CSA = 3.14 × 75 = 235.5 cm²
The area of the sheet required to make the cap is 235.5cm² (rounded to the nearest integer).
